Kawasaki is taking strong strides in developing sustainable and cleaner powertrain sources. The Japanese superbike brand unveiled its first electric motorcycles– Ninja e-1 and Z e-1– earlier this year. This was followed by the Z7 Hybrid bike which was also showcased at the recently concluded India Bike Week 2023.

It appears, Kawasaki isn’t stopping there and developing another hybrid motorcycle which resembles the Versys. A patent image leaked on the internet suggests that Kawasaki is working on a new Versys featuring a hybrid powertrain. This could be revolutionary since adventure tourers like Versys are currently the fastest growing segment of motorcycles.

In recent years, ADV bikes have been the preferred choice for riders venturing in long tours. Hence, fuel efficiency becomes a very important factor when it comes to buying an adventure bike. A hybrid powered ADV can be the exact solution to this problem.

Kawasaki Versys hybrid patent leaked

As per the patent image, the setup seems very familiar to the one used in the Z7 hybrid bike which was earlier presented at EICMA 2023. This hybrid setup consists of a 9kW electric motor and a 1.4kWh battery paired with a 451cc, liquid-cooled, parallel-twin engine. This unit delivers a peak power output of 69 bhp.

Therefore, the combined output from the engine and electric motor is most likely to be higher. The rider can also switch from fully electric to ICE once the battery runs out of juice. Kawasaki could also offer the bike with manual or automatic transmission options. The patent also illustrates a cooling system similar to the one used in the Ninja Z7 prototype.

In terms of features, we expect Kawasaki to offer full LED illumination, and digital instrumentation among others. Currently, Kawasaki offers the Versys 650 with a 649cc, parallel-twin, liquid-cooled motor mated to a six-speed gearbox. This powertrain kicks out 65 bhp and 69 Nm of peak torque.
